Popular Conference Centers

Choose conference centers that offer integrated A/V, flexible meeting rooms, and on-site catering so your agenda runs smoothly. Large hotels and dedicated conference facilities in Ottawa provide rooms that scale from boardroom-size (10–20) to ballroom-capacity (300+), plus breakout rooms and registration areas.

Look for these practical features when you book:

  • A/V and staging: built-in projectors, sound systems, and technician support.
  • Connectivity: high-speed wired and wireless internet with redundancy.
  • Logistics: loading docks, freight elevators, and ample on-site or nearby parking.
  • Catering and breakout spaces: in-house kitchens and multiple room configurations.

Ask for floor plans, ONSITE technical rates, and a sample timeline to avoid surprises the day of your event.

Historic Event Spaces

Historic buildings offer character and strong visual impact for receptions, galas, and award ceremonies, but they often come with specific constraints. Many heritage venues in Ottawa feature original architectural details, limited modern rigging points, and noise restrictions, so plan technical and timeline needs early.

Key considerations include:

  • Capacity limits: confirm seated vs. standing allowances and accessible routing.
  • Technical constraints: surface protection rules, limited power, and HVAC schedules.
  • Permit and insurance needs: some properties require specialized permits or certificates of insurance.
  • Aesthetic opportunities: historic backdrops reduce décor costs and boost photography value.

Request a site visit to verify sightlines, staging options, and where guests will check in or coat-check.

Unique Outdoor Locations

Outdoor venues in Ottawa range from riverfront parks to formal gardens and urban plazas, offering strong visuals and natural ventilation for festivals, company picnics, and product launches. Seasonal weather, municipal permits, and noise bylaws will shape what you can do and when.

Plan around these essentials:

  • Permits and approvals: city permits, temporary structure permissions, and sound restrictions.
  • Infrastructure needs: power, generators, portable washrooms, and waste management.
  • Accessibility and transport: shuttle options, transit proximity, and marked accessible paths.
  • Backup plans: tenting and alternate indoor locations in case of inclement weather.

Coordinate logistics early with city offices or venue managers to secure dates and utility access.

Choosing the Best Ottawa Venue

Focus on the practical details that affect your day: how many people the space truly fits, what food and service options are available on site, and whether guests can reach and park at the location without hassle.

Venue Capacity and Layout

Confirm the venue’s maximum capacities for different setups: theatre, classroom, cocktail, and seated dinner. Ask for floor plans with measured dimensions and fixed features (pillars, stages, bars) so you can map seating, AV, and emergency exits accurately.

Evaluate sightlines and traffic flow. For presentations, check sightlines from the back rows; for dinners, ensure tables won’t block service aisles. If you need breakout rooms, verify their sizes and whether doors can remain open for supervision. Measure ceiling height when you plan elaborate lighting or suspended signage.

Request a site visit during a booked event when possible. That shows real bounds on noise, crowding, and service speed. Get written confirmation of final capacity limits and any movable furniture the venue provides.

Catering and On-Site Services

Decide whether you require in-house catering or can bring an external caterer; many Ottawa venues like hotels and restaurant-affiliated event spaces restrict outside food. Review sample menus, tasting policies, and minimum spend or per-person guarantees.

Clarify service levels: plated vs. buffet vs. stations, bar staffing and liquor licensing, dietary accommodations (gluten-free, halal, vegan), and timing for courses. Ask about kitchen capacity and warming areas if you use an outside caterer.

Confirm what event staff the venue supplies: Banquet manager, servers, coat check, security. Get pricing for overtime, corkage, and gratuities in writing. Verify cleanup responsibilities and any penalties for food waste or reserved kitchen times.

Accessibility and Parking

Check public transit links and nearby OC Transpo stops if many guests won’t drive. For out-of-town attendees, list nearby hotels within a 10–15 minute drive or walking distance.

Confirm on-site parking counts and costs; ask about overflow lots and accessible parking spaces. If parking is limited, plan for valet, shuttle service, or discounted ride-share drop-off points.

Assess physical accessibility: entrance ramps, automatic doors, elevator dimensions, accessible washrooms, and stage access. Request an accessibility map the venue provides for guests with mobility, hearing, or visual needs.
